While hunting season started off slowly for me, I made up for it in late September when Vanessa and I snuck into a remote basin in the Alberta Rockies and found a trophy bighorn ram. I managed to sneak within 59 yards of him and dispatched the big ram with one shot from the 7mm STW. It turned into a 15-hour day with heavy packs and Vanessa took a bad fall and fractured her elbow but she toughed it out and returned with me the following day for a second load of meat.
The following weekend, buddy Dan Mosier came down to hunt for bighorn ewes
with us and he took a nice fat ewe that will provide some great meals this winter.
